Why Should I Strength Train?

Learning the four main barbell lifts—squat, deadlift, bench press, and overhead press—is the best way to build full-body strength and help you move better in your every day life.  These exercises aren’t just for athletes or bodybuilders—they’re natural movements that help you build overall strength and stay physically and mentally healthy. Whether you're picking up groceries, climbing stairs, or playing with your kids, these exercises make everyday activities easier and safer. Plus, getting stronger boosts your confidence and energy, making you feel better overall.

The great thing about these movements is that anyone can learn them with the right guidance. You don’t have to lift heavy weights to see benefits—just practicing good form and staying consistent will improve your strength over time. As you get better, you’ll notice improvements in your posture, balance, and even your mood! 

The best part is that strength training is for everyone, no matter your age or fitness level. It’s never too late to start, and every small step brings progress. With patience and consistency, you’ll build not just physical strength, but the resilience to tackle challenges both in and out of the gym!
